Engine breakdown / loose tensioner

Timing / tensioner

$420

Triumph 400-series bike engine broke down; service initially said warranty would cover the repair, then rejected the claim after finding the oil change was delayed by two months. The stated fault was a loose tensioner, and the centre offered only one part covered while leaving the owner with about ₹35,000 remaining cost.
